THE NATIONAL PARKS OF THE UNITED STATES

This should not be viewed as the usual type of book about our National Parks. It is written with a specific purpose- to summarize the origins, beginnings, development, organization of the National Park Service so that those countries (his particular interest is the Spanish speaking countries) who have no such setup can profit thereby. He shares too in these pages his enthusiasm for the scenic panorama of America and in particular the thirty National Parks he briefly describes, and those other preserves which foster the concept of conservation, preservation of historical sites, protection of Indians. An Appendix traces the influence of Spain in our National Parks and monuments- again a factor of special concern to the audience he is approaching. There will be some peripheral value and possible sales for tourist background reading and for a brief survey to be used in social studies in schools.
